Best DNS & Bind Books
What is DNS? DNS Explained
What is DNS?
DNS settings are critical components of any network. They provide the mapping between a domain name and its associated IP address, allowing users to easily access websites or services without having to remember complex numerical addresses. This article will discuss the importance of DNS configurations from both an administrator’s and user’s perspective, as well as how to properly configure them in different scenarios.
The Domain Name System (DNS) is a hierarchical system for translating human-readable hostnames into machine-readable IP addresses. It supports web browsing by resolving requests from clients such as computers, servers, routers and other network devices. Without proper configuration, users may experience slow response times or even be unable to connect to certain services or sites at all. Administrators must understand the fundamentals of DNS settings and ensure they are configured correctly in order to maximize performance on their networks.
Additionally, when configuring DNS settings it is important that administrators understand the various types available so that they can choose the most appropriate one for their environment. Commonly used types include authoritative name servers, recursive resolvers and caching nameservers among others. In this article we will explore each type of DNS setting in detail so administrators can make informed decisions about which one best meets their needs.
What Is Dns?
DNS is the digital gateway that connects users to websites and services. It acts as a bridge between humans and computers, allowing us to communicate with technology using easy-to-remember domain names instead of difficult-to-recall IP addresses. The Domain Name System (DNS) is the foundation for an efficient network infrastructure – it plays an essential role in how the internet works.
The DNS structure consists of two primary components: DNS servers and DNS queries. DNS servers store information about domains and subdomains, including their associated IP address or hostname record. When a user types in a domain name into their web browser, this triggers a DNS query which looks up the corresponding IP address from the server’s records. This process allows the browser to connect to the right computer on the internet to display its content.
Many organizations use various types of external and internal DNS servers for different purposes such as hosting public websites, creating private networks, providing secure access points, etc. Each organization has its own set of requirements when setting up these systems so they can configure them accordingly with appropriate dns records like A/AAAA/CNAME records, MX Records, TXT Records etc. By understanding how each type of record functions within their system, administrators are able to make sure all requests are properly routed within their network environment.
Configuring Dns Records
DNS stands for Domain Name System, a key component of the internet responsible for translating URLs into IP addresses. Configuring DNS records is essential to the proper functioning and operation of any website or online service. Each domain name requires several different types of DNS record in order to enable clients to locate them on the web.
To properly configure a domain’s DNS settings, one must first start by identifying which type of record is required. Commonly used records include A (address) records, CNAME (canonical name) records, MX (mail exchange) records and SRV (service locator) records. Once these have been identified, they can be added to the domain’s zone file at the hosting provider’s control panel. The exact process will vary depending on the provider but typically involves entering some information about each record such as its type and value before saving it in the system.
Once all necessary DNS records have been configured and saved, they should become active within minutes or hours depending on how quickly changes propagate through the Internet’s distributed network architecture. This ensures that users are able to access websites without experiencing long delays due to outdated information being cached along their route from server-to-server. Having accurate and up-to-date DNS settings allows visitors to reach a website more quickly while also preventing potential security issues caused by incorrect configuration values. By understanding how DNS works and taking time to properly configure its settings, organizations can ensure their services remain available across multiple devices around the world with minimal disruption or downtime.
Benefits Of Dns Settings
Recent studies have shown that businesses can reduce their IT costs by up to 37% when they make the move to managed DNS services. The use of managed DNS solutions provides many benefits, including:
- Efficiency: With a reliable and secure system in place, companies will experience improved efficiency as well as increased uptime for mission-critical systems. This enables faster response times and better customer service.
- Security: By utilizing an efficient DNS solution such as DNSSEC or Sender Policy Framework (SPF), organizations are able to protect themselves from attack vectors such as Man-in-the-Middle attacks, cache poisoning, and phishing attempts. Additionally, with additional layers of redundancy built into the system, organizations can ensure that their data is kept safe.
- Reliability: A robust and reliable DNS infrastructure ensures stable performance even during peak traffic periods or unexpected outages. In addition, it allows for quick recovery if something does go wrong.
- Speed: Faster load times lead to improved user experiences which result in higher levels of customer satisfaction. Utilizing advanced caching techniques in conjunction with Anycast routing also helps improve page load speed while reducing latency issues caused by network congestion or geographical distance between server locations.
- Costs: Managed DNS services offer cost savings through reduced hardware requirements and simplified management processes without sacrificing reliability or security. Furthermore, due to its scalability potential – no matter how large the organization grows – there are never any added upfront investments required for setup or maintenance fees associated with managing the system internally.
Overall, utilizing managed DNS solutions offers substantial improvements over traditional methods when it comes to increasing business productivity and profitability while ensuring high levels of security and reliability at a fraction of the cost compared to other options available on the market today. Moving forward into troubleshooting dns issues brings further opportunities for organizational growth and success.
Troubleshooting Dns Issues
DNS troubleshooting is a critical component of network administration. When dealing with DNS issues, it is important to have the right tools and strategies in place to quickly identify and resolve problems. To begin the process of resolving DNS problems, one must first determine what type of issue they are facing. Common types of DNS issues include resolution errors, connection delays, or server-side configuration errors. Once the problem has been identified, there are various methods for resolving these issues such as reconfiguring settings on local machines, clearing DNS caches, restarting services, or performing manual lookup tests.
For more complex scenarios involving multiple servers across different networks, additional steps may be necessary. This could involve configuring name servers correctly or implementing proper forwarding rules between domains. Additionally, examining log files can provide valuable insights into potential causes of any underlying issue. Being able to effectively interpret logs can help isolate discrepancies that could contribute to an unresolved DNS query conflict or misconfigured settings.
Overall effective dns troubleshooting requires having the right tools and skillset in order to quickly diagnose and address any issues that arise within a network infrastructure environment. Utilizing appropriate strategies tailored towards specific circumstances can ensure quick resolutions while minimizing downtime for users connected to affected systems. As such, it is essential for professionals responsible for managing these environments to stay up-to-date with best practices when it comes to dns resolution strategies and techniques used by industry experts today.
Frequently Asked Questions
How Often Should I Update My Dns Settings?
The question of how often one should update their DNS settings is an important one for network administrators. Much like a lighthouse keeper ensuring the beacon’s light never fades, it is up to those responsible for managing networks to keep them running optimally and efficiently through regular maintenance. Changing DNS settings must be done with frequency in order to ensure the most reliable results and best performance. This can range from daily adjustments depending on the level of security needed or when changes are required due to new software being installed or other factors that could affect user experience.
The key elements of any good DNS management strategy include regularly updating your server’s records as well as monitoring what changes have been made and why they were necessary. With this knowledge, administrators can adjust their DNS settings accordingly without having to guess about what effects these changes may have upon the network. As such, a periodic review of the current DNS configuration is recommended so that any necessary updates can be quickly identified and implemented before any issues arise. Additionally, careful consideration should also be given to whether particular nameservers will need additional modifications based on user feedback or other external sources; if there are no complaints then extra tweaks might not be needed at all.
In order to guarantee optimal functionality across different platforms, domains and users alike, it is critical that proper measures are taken in regards to changing DNS settings in accordance with whatever specific requirements exist within each environment – both local and remote – while also considering future growth potentials. To help mitigate risks associated with ongoing alterations, experts recommend employing automated solutions whenever possible which would reduce manual intervention while simultaneously increasing overall accuracy levels regardless of size or complexity of system architecture.
What Is The Difference Between An A Record And A Cname Record?
A record and CNAME record are two important DNS records which need to be understood in order to properly configure a domain’s settings. The difference between the two is that an A record points directly to an IP address, while a CNAME record can point to another domain name instead of an IP address.
An A record is used for mapping hostnames onto IPv4 addresses, thus creating a connection from the given domain or subdomain name to its corresponding IP address. For example, if one wants their website URL www.example.com to open up their web page hosted on 188.8.131.52 then they will need an A Record with www as the Hostname and 184.108.40.206 as the Destination/Target IP Address set up within their DNS Settings panel (or equivalent).
A CNAME is similar but different than an A Record because it creates an alias redirecting visitors who type in a certain URL into another specified location online; it does not point directly at an IP address like A Records do. This type of redirection allows multiple domains or subdomains to all lead back to the same main source without having to make changes across each individual domain pointing them all separately towards the original destination every time there’s a change made such as when hosting moves locations or URLs are updated from http://www – > https://www etc… As long as all variations of the domain have been created through CNAME records, updating just one variation will update everyone else automatically too due to being linked together by this method whenever needed so no further configuration should ever be required again once complete initially..
In order for efficient functioning of any website, both types of DNS records must be considered when setting up proper network infrastructure and understanding how best to use them will aid significantly in ensuring optimal performance going forward regardless of future requirements that may arise over time due to changes in traffic patterns or other external factors beyond control of those managing these configurations day-to-day.
Are There Any Risks Associated With Changing My Dns Settings?
When making changes to DNS settings, there is always a risk that needs to be taken into consideration. It can be easy for an inexperienced user to make mistakes when changing the settings which could have serious consequences on their network security and performance. While a change in the DNS settings can provide many benefits, it is important to weigh up the risks associated with such a task before proceeding.
The primary risks of making changes to DNS settings involve third party services. If users are not careful about choosing who they trust with managing their domain names, they may end up running afoul of malicious actors or unreliable providers who might not take proper care of their data. Additionally, if users fail to update their records regularly, this could lead to problems like website downtime or slow loading times for certain websites due to incorrect routing instructions being sent out by the server.
Apart from these issues, another potential source of risk involves the possibility that hackers may gain access to sensitive information stored within your network through spoofed IP addresses or other malicious tactics designed to compromise security protocols in place at your organization. As such, it is essential that any changes made to DNS settings are done so carefully and securely; this includes ensuring regular updates are carried out as well as configuring strong authentication mechanisms whenever possible. Additionally, monitoring logs and staying aware of any suspicious activity should also help minimize any potential damage caused by unauthorized changes being made to networks’ configurations.
In light of all this, it is clear that caution must be exercised when altering DNS settings – regardless of whether those modifications were intended for increased functionality or enhanced security measures – because even small missteps could potentially result in catastrophic outcomes for organizations reliant upon them for daily operations.
How Do I Know If My Dns Settings Are Secure?
It is important to ensure that DNS settings are secure, which can be done by performing a security check. This process involves assessing the existing configuration and making sure it meets industry standards for maximum protection from cyber threats. There are various steps one can take to protect their network against malicious attacks such as installing firewalls and antivirus software, however, an extra layer of security can be added through secure DNS settings. To determine if current DNS settings are secure, there are several methods available including a manual assessment or automated tools that scan networks for vulnerabilities and provide detailed reports on any potential weaknesses.
To start, users should first understand how DNS works in order to properly assess its security levels. The Domain Name System (DNS) translates domain names into IP addresses so that computers connected to the internet can communicate with each other. It acts like a directory service linking websites to their associated IP address. As such, proper management of this system is essential since it’s the foundation of web traffic flow between servers and clients over the Internet. A variety of factors contribute to securing the system including strong authentication protocols, encryption algorithms, and hardening techniques used when configuring services related to DNS.
In addition, various online tools exist which allow users to perform checks on their own systems in order to identify any possible risks associated with their current DNS configurations. These tests will compare passwords strength and encryption types being used as well as flagging any issues detected within the setup itself or changes made by third-party entities without authorization. By running regular scans across networks using these kinds of tools administrators can ensure they adhere to best practices for keeping their data safe from malicious actors who may seek access via weakly configured DNS settings.
Can I Use A Third-Party Dns Provider?
Using a third-party DNS provider can be beneficial for many organizations, as it allows them to customize their settings and take advantage of the latest technologies. For example, Acme Corporation recently changed its DNS provider from an internal system to a third-party one in order to increase security and ensure faster speeds.
When considering changing providers, however, there are several factors that must be taken into account. First and foremost is the level of security offered by the new provider. Research should be done to determine if they use encryption protocols such as DNSSEC or TLS 1.3 which help protect user data from being intercepted or modified during transmission. Additionally, some providers offer advanced features such as DDoS protection against malicious attacks or automated malware scanning for added security measures.
The next consideration is cost; most third-party providers charge per domain name registered on their servers but provide additional services like web hosting or email support at additional costs. Organizations should weigh these options carefully before deciding which company best fits their needs. Finally, it’s important to remember that regardless of who provides the DNS service, all users will still need to make sure they keep their own devices up-to-date with the latest software patches and antivirus programs in order to further secure their networks.
In summary, when looking at switching DNS providers there are multiple considerations that should be made including security protocols used by the new provider, cost associated with registration and extra services provided, as well as ensuring personal devices remain updated with the latest hardware and software configurations for optimal levels of security over time
DNS settings are an important part of any website or online operation. It is critical to ensure that your settings are up-to-date and secure in order to reduce the risk of cyber threats such as hacking and data theft. A record and CNAME records are two different types of entries used when setting up DNS. Both have different use cases and should be chosen carefully based on the particular needs of a website or network. While changing one’s DNS settings can come with certain risks, doing so thoughtfully and with adequate protection measures in place can help mitigate these risks. As the old adage goes: “An ounce of prevention is worth a pound of cure” – this certainly applies to making sure you keep your DNS settings updated and secure at all times.